Using Charm at cutover to handle deleted objects

122 Views

Hello experts,

System landscape contains of dual landscap meaning one project ladnscape and one maintenance landscape.

Project: D01 >T01 >Q01 ( no charm )

Maint: DEV >QAS >PRD ( charm is used )

At project Go Live cutover is done från Project line Q01 to Maint DEV.

All transports imported in Q01 is added manually to import queue of Maint DEV and imported.

After that 1 WB request and 1 Cust. request is created via charm and all objects from the

cutover transports imported are added to those chamr transports. Then charm handles the

transport process through the maint landscape up to production.

Problem

=======

If cutover transports contains deletion of objects, the transports are imported to DEV maint, object is deleted.

When including all objects from cutover transports into the two charm transports it will then ofcourse fail during

releae of the transports on the deleted objects as they no longer exist in DEV maint. This is of course not a specific

charm problem but a TMS problem. Or not even a problem it is as it should be.

Question

========

Is there any way of handling this scenario, can charm in any way handle this ?
